The Hypertension Score in 65774, Weaubleau, Missouri is 8 out of 100 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.

83.09 percent of the population in 65774 drive to work alone. 0.00 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 64.39 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 14.21 percent of the residents in 65774 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 2.35 members with about 2.35 cars available per household.

An estimate of 84.43 percent of the residents in 65774 has some form of health insurance. 48.35 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 49.51 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.

A resident in 65774 would have to travel an average of 49.56 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Lakeland Behavioral Health System . In a 20-mile radius, there are 0 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 65774, Weaubleau, Missouri.

As of , an estimate of 1,214 residents live in 65774 with a median age of 44.4 years. 21.42 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 19.60 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 35.66 percent of the residents in 65774 is currently married, and 11.35 percent of the population has never been married.

The monthly median household income in 65774 is $4,172.17.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 65774 is approximately $600. The median household spends about 14.38 percent of their income on housing.
